人与大猩猩,黑猩猩和猩猩亲缘关系的探讨

摘    要:有关人锆超科的系统发育仍然存在刍议。争论焦点在与大猩猩和黑猩猩哪 个关系更近一点。酪氨酸酶是黑色素合成中的关键酶,酪氨酶基因的突变将导致白化病。测定了人猿科中大猩猩,黑猩猩、猩猩和长臂锆产基因全部5个外显子的DNA序列。

关 键 词:  大猩猩  黑猩猩  猩猩  亲缘关系  酪氨酸酶基因

The Relationship Among Human, Gorilla, Chimpanzee and Orangutan
DING Bo, ZHANG Ya-Ping.The Relationship Among Human, Gorilla, Chimpanzee and Orangutan[J].Journal of Genetics and Genomics,1999,26(6):604-609.
Authors:DING Bo  ZHANG Ya-Ping
Abstract:The Phylogeny of howhnoid is still an open question. The contrary point is which relationship is more closed related between human and gorilla and human and chimpanzee. Tyrosinase is the essential enzyme in melanogenesis. The mutation of tyrosinase gene causes albinism. The five e-cons of tyrosinase gene were sequenced for gorilla, chimpanzee, orangutan and gibbon in hominoid. Combined with the human tyrosinase gene sequence, the gene tree was constructed using parsimony method. The results show that the relationship between human and gorilla is more closed related than betWeen human and chimpanzee.
Keywords:Hominoid  Tyrosinase gene  Phylogeny
